2.11.5
Data Pattern
Double‐click Data Pattern to open the Data Pattern definition dialog.
Figure 2.17: SAS: Data Pattern Dialog
SAS vs. SATA: SATA Dialog shows Port at the top and does not show SSP or STP.
Define the data pattern for capture or exclusion from capture and click OK.
Note:
When entering the data pattern in the “Data” section of this screen, if you are reading the data
pattern from a recorded trace, you must reverse the order of the bytes listed for each DWORD
entered. For example, if you want to capture (or exclude) “00 01 02 03” (as displayed in the
trace), you must enter this pattern as “03 02 01 00”.
